Education High school diploma or general education degree (GED) required. Experience Six months to one-year related experience and/or training in customer service or reception, preferably in a medical office setting. Certificates, Licenses, and/or Registrations Current Basic Life Support (BLS) Certification or willingness to be certified within 90 days of hire. Technical Skills Familiarity with the Healthcare industry. Ability to type 45 WPM and operate a 10-key calculator by touch. Exceptional writing, editing, and proofreading skills. Excellent organization and time-management skills. Excellent computer skills, including the Microsoft Office Suite (Outlook, Word, PowerPoint, and Excel). Knowledge of and compliance with HIPAA regulations. Excellent customer service skills to respond appropriately and interact positively with upset customers. Knowledge of phone customer service best practices and experienced with multi-line call centers. Physical Demands & Work Environment The Patient Services Coordinator is expected to spend the majority of time in a sitting position, with occasional walking and standing. Use of hands and arms will be required. Because of exposure to patient records of all types, the highest standard of patient confidentiality and privacy as established by business policy and HIPAA requirements must be maintained.
